The manufacturer of espadrilles Payote wants to make a million pairs a year in Perpignan

Payote, manufacturer of “made in France” espadrilles, wants to create a new factory to meet the high demand. The factory will be open to the public.

The great comeback of espadrilles: in the south of France, in Perpignan, Payote is overwhelmed with requests for its “made in France” canvas sneakers. The Catalan company registered three million orders in 2022, far from the 80,000 pairs that it usually manufactures each year.

“It is a flagship product, which is also very popular abroad,” rejoices its president Olivier Gelly, who created the company seven years earlier. Not being able to respond to all requests, Payote has so far only been able to open two stores, in Perpignan and Toulouse.

Because Payote’s goal now is to scale production. The company wants to set up its own factory, capable of producing a million pairs of espadrilles each year – the manufacture of espadrilles is now carried out in collaboration with a company in Mauléon-Licharre, in the Basque Country.

Two million euros, including 500,000 euros in crowdfunding, are on the table to pull the new 2,500 m² factory off the ground, to be built at the back of the Perpignan store at the end of 2024.

Escape game and virtual games

Payote, above all, intends to open its factory to the public. An amusement park dedicated to the espadrille, in a way. Within the site you can find a workshop to make your own shoes, virtual games, a cinema or even an escape game.

About 80 jobs should be created. The factory will be in charge of assembling the different parts of the shoe, and the company itself will not manufacture the raw materials. “We are trying to repatriate as close as possible everything that can be done”, specifies Olivier Gelly. The thread and stripes are French, the canvas is French, Italian or Spanish, the grape pomace (a synthetic leather) is also Italian, while the jute for the sole comes from Bangladesh, waiting to find a satisfactory alternative in French hemp.
